Transaction 805cdb553defa2183bf5699c8f1a093434a123f07d1eb8e78ded5a3dec5caf67
1 Input
1 Output
-
805cdb553defa2183bf5699c8f1a093434a123f07d1eb8e78ded5a3dec5caf67:0
- value
- 450795
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5da5073c4d386782000beecf653f8688fdbb7b8
- address
- bc1quhd9qu7y6wr8sgqqhmk0v5lcdz8ahdacl4r696